
Authorities are investigating the death of a man found Tuesday morning with a gunshot wound in a Humboldt Park alley.
Witnesses said they heard a gunshot shortly before 6 a.m. and then found a man unresponsive in an alley in the 2900 block of West North Avenue, according to Chicago police.
Paramedics found a 43-year-old man bleeding with a gunshot wound to the side of his head, police said. He was pronounced dead at the scene.
A weapon was found near his body, police said.
It was not immediately clear if the man shot himself or was killed by someone else.
A police investigation into the death is pending a ruling on the manner of death by the Cook County medical examiner’s office. Autopsy results are expected to be released Wednesday afternoon.
